Services for Tawanda Jackson, 44, of Picayune, will be held Thursday, February 11, 2016 at 11:00 a.m. at St. Matthews Baptist Church where Rev. Dr. Michael Kelley is Pastor. The Reverend Clinton Baker is officiating at the service.
Tawanda Yvette Jackson was born on June 8, 1971 in Picayune to Cephus Jackson, Jr. and the late Zellena Arlene Bender.
Tawanda was baptized at an early age at St. Matthews Baptist Church under the leadership of the late Reverend E. J. Woodard. She was crowned Queen of the Pastor’s Aide when her grandmother (the late Pearlie Bender) served as president.
Tawanda was a member of the Picayune Memorial High School graduating class of 1989. While in school, Tawanda was very active in pageants and talent shows. She was crowned Queen of the Shades of Ebony Civic and Social Club where she received an education scholarship. She attended Alcorn State University. She later accepted a position as a teacher’s aide at Picayune Headstart (MAP). She then relocated to Gulfport, MS where she was the manager of the Salvation Army surplus store until her health failed.
Tawanda Yvette Jackson transitioned to her heavenly home on February 4, 2016 at Garden Park Memorial Hospital, Gulfport, MS, embraced by her loving family. She was preceded in death by her mother, Zellena Bender; maternal grandparents, Leonard G. & Annie Pearl Baker Bender; and paternal grandfather, Cephus Jackson, Sr.
She leaves to cherish her love and memories, her daughter, Tivoli Arlene Jackson, of Gulfport, MS; her father & step-mother, Cephus, Jr. & Donna Jackson, of Jonesboro, GA; two sisters, Monica (Greg) Jackson-Marcotte, of Tampa, FL and Kia Jenell (Anton) Dawson, of Germantown, MD; two uncles, Leonard George (Pat) Bender, Jr., of Picayune, MS, and Percy Manning, of Gulfport, MS; three aunts, Joyce Jackson (Raymond) Russell, of Prichard, AL, Cordelia Jackson Knox, of Montgomery, AL, and Sharon Jackson (Frank) Philpott, of Hogansville, GA; paternal grandmother, Darnell Jackson Abner, of Montgomery, AL; a devoted friend, Henry Williams, of Gulfport, MS; and a host of cousins and friends.
Visitation will be Wednesday, February 10, 2016 at Brown’s Funeral Home Chapel from 5:00 – 7:00 p.m. Thursday, February 11, 2016 at St. Matthews Baptist Church from 10:00 -11:00 a.m. Interment will be in Picayune Cemetery. Entrusted to Brown’s Funeral Home.
